By Greg Seubert


Oconto Falls handed Waupaca a 64-25 loss Feb. 8 in a North Eastern Conference girls’ basketball game.

The Panthers scored the game’s first 10 points and Waupaca never got any closer than eight points the rest of the way.

Waupaca trailed 32-14 at halftime and Oconto Falls outscored the Comets 32-11 in the second half.

Rossi Wehmeyer led the Comets with 11 points and Hailey Peitersen led the Panthers with 11.

Waupaca traveled to Freedom Feb. 11 to face the Irish and will wrap up the regular season Thursday, Feb. 17, in Appleton against Fox Valley Lutheran.
